AdvisorShares Dorsey Wright ADR ETF (NASDAQ:AADR – Get Free Report) was the recipient of a large decline in short interest in the month of July. As of July 15th, there was short interest totaling 31 shares, a decline of 81.2% from the June 30th total of 165 shares. Currently, 0.0% of the company’s shares are short sold. Based on an average daily trading volume, of 1,257 shares, the short-interest ratio is currently 0.0 days.

AdvisorShares Dorsey Wright ADR ETF Company Profile
The AdvisorShares Dorsey Wright ADR ETF (AADR)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the BNY Mellon Classic ADR index. The fund is an actively managed ETF that aims to outperform the international markets outside the US by holding ADRs with high relative strength.
